Transaction ce1650276c47b84c8f8214fa08b17f3014a311f860bf18164d166a545aaf8450

1 Input
2 Outputs
  • ce1650276c47b84c8f8214fa08b17f3014a311f860bf18164d166a545aaf8450:0
  • value  21450650
    address  3L6hcwDwdmLH6KYWscf1RewndAru5QzLvz
  • ce1650276c47b84c8f8214fa08b17f3014a311f860bf18164d166a545aaf8450:1
  • value  459300
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c